Business Setup & Licensing

Need Help?

+971 50 982 8904

info@mafazauae.com

Contact Us
Business Consultant

Business Setup in UAE – Complete Guide for Entrepreneurs & Investors (2025)

Business setup in UAE is one of the most attractive opportunities for entrepreneurs, startups, and international investors looking to enter a fast-growing, stable, and globally connected market. The United Arab Emirates offers a pro-business environment, modern infrastructure, flexible regulations, and access to regional and international markets.

This page is written as a fresh, non-duplicated, high-authority guide focused specifically on business setup in the UAE as a whole, not limited to Dubai alone. It targets users searching for country-level guidance and is structured to rank competitively on Google.

Why Choose the UAE for Business Setup?

The UAE consistently ranks among the top destinations for global business due to its investor-friendly policies and economic stability.

Key Advantages of Business Setup in UAE

  • Strategic location connecting Asia, Europe, and Africa

  • 100% foreign ownership for many activities

  • No personal income tax

  • Competitive corporate tax framework

  • World-class infrastructure and logistics

  • Strong banking and financial system

  • Political and economic stability

These benefits make business setup in UAE ideal for long-term growth and international expansion.

Ready to Start Your Business in UAE?

MAFAZAUAE is here to make the entire process simple, fast, and stress-free.

👉 Share your business activity and we will provide
Full cost breakdown + Best jurisdiction recommendation + Setup plan.

Types of Business Setup Options in the UAE

Choosing the right structure is the foundation of successful company formation.

Mainland

Mainland Business Setup in UAE

Mainland companies allow businesses to operate anywhere in the UAE and engage directly with the local market.

Best suited for:

  • Retail and trading companies

  • Service-based businesses

  • Companies targeting UAE customers

Mainland businesses are regulated by the respective emirate’s Department of Economic Development (DED).

freezone

Free Zone Business Setup in UAE

Free zones are one of the most popular options for foreign investors.

Key benefits:

  • 100% foreign ownership

  • Full profit repatriation

  • Simplified setup process

  • Customs duty exemptions (subject to conditions)

Free zones are ideal for consulting, IT services, e-commerce, and international trading.

offshore

Offshore Business Setup in UAE

Offshore companies are suitable for international operations and asset protection.

Best suited for:

  • Holding companies

  • Global trading

  • Intellectual property ownership

Offshore companies cannot conduct business within the UAE market.

Every business in the UAE must obtain the correct license based on its activity.

Commercial License

Issued for trading, import-export, and commercial activities.

Professional License

Issued for service-oriented businesses such as consultancy, IT, and marketing.

Industrial License

Issued for manufacturing, production, and industrial activities.

The license type directly impacts setup cost and compliance requirements.

Step-by-Step Process for Business Setup in UAE

Cost of Business Setup in UAE

The cost of business setup in UAE depends on multiple factors:

  • Emirate and jurisdiction

  • Business activity

  • License type

  • Number of visas

  • Office space requirements

Documents Required for Business Setup in UAE

  • Passport copies of shareholders

  • Passport-size photographs

  • Visa copy or entry stamp

  • Trade name reservation certificate

  • Business activity details

Additional approvals may apply for regulated activities.

UAE Residence Visas for Business Owners

Business owners and employees require residence visas to live and work in the UAE.

Common Visa Types

  • Investor visa

  • Partner visa

  • Employment visa

Visa costs typically range from AED 3,500 to AED 5,500 per visa.

Popular Emirates for Business Setup in UAE

  • Dubai – Commercial hub and global business center

  • Abu Dhabi – Strong industrial and government-linked opportunities

  • Sharjah – Cost-effective options for SMEs

  • Ajman & Ras Al Khaimah – Affordable free zone solutions

Each emirate offers unique advantages depending on business type.

Common Mistakes to Avoid During Business Setup in UAE

  • Choosing the wrong license type

  • Selecting an unsuitable jurisdiction

  • Underestimating setup and renewal costs

  • Ignoring compliance and visa requirements

Professional guidance minimizes risks and delays.

Why Choose MAFAZA for Business Setup in UAE?

Dubai Sky View

MAFAZA provides end-to-end business setup solutions in the UAE, including:

  • Business consultation and planning

  • License and jurisdiction selection

  • Cost optimization

  • Visa and compliance support

  • Post-setup services

Our experienced consultants ensure a smooth and transparent setup process.

❓Frequently Asked Questions (FAQs)

Yes, the UAE offers one of the most foreign-investor-friendly environments globally.

Yes, many business activities allow full foreign ownership.

Typically between 3–10 working days.

Not required for most free zone and many mainland activities.

Final Thoughts on Business Setup in UAE

Business setup in UAE provides entrepreneurs with unmatched access to global markets, tax advantages, and a stable regulatory environment. With proper planning and expert support, setting up a business in the UAE can be fast, cost-effective, and scalable.

📞 Contact MAFAZA today to start your business setup in the UAE with confidence.

Contact Information

We’d love to hear from you! Drop us a message and let’s start the conversation.

Have Questions?

Send us a Message